This week on GAEA Talks, Graeme Scott sits down with Dr Roman Yampolskiy - the computer scientist credited with coining the term "AI safety", tenured Associate Professor at the University of Louisville, founder of the Cyber Security Lab, and author of AI: Unexplainable, Unpredictable, Uncontrollable.Roman has spent over fifteen years working at the intersection of AI safety, cybersecurity and behavioural biometrics - making him one of the longest-serving researchers in a field most people only discovered in 2023. He holds a PhD in Computer Science from the University at Buffalo and a combined BS/MS with High Honours from Rochester Institute of Technology. Listed among the world's top 2% of scientists by Stanford University, he has published over 100 peer-reviewed papers and multiple books. While the rest of the AI world races to build more capable systems, Roman's singular focus has been making sure humanity doesn't regret their creation.In this episode, Roman delivers the most direct and unflinching warning about artificial superintelligence that GAEA Talks has ever recorded. He reveals that current AI systems are already lying, blackmailing and attempting to escape their test environments - and that a Darwinian process is selecting for better deception with every generation. He explains why the mathematical impossibility results he discovered mean we may never be able to control a system smarter than us. Graeme Scott and Professor Yi-Zhe Song - Co-Founders of Turing Elite Research Labs - announce the launch of a new venture built to democratise AI from the United Kingdom, and debut the 'Me' augmented human AI model running entirely on local compute.This episode begins as a real conversation between Graeme and Professor Song - then, without warning, transitions into Turing Elite's augmented human AI. The challenge to every viewer: decide for yourself where reality ends and AI begins.This is the first public demonstration of the 'Me' model - a professional-grade, private augmented human AI trained on a fraction of the compute used by comparable systems and deployed to run entirely on local compute. It delivers two-person emotional interaction simultaneously, benchmarked against the real people it represents. Their known voices, expressions, characteristics and personalities. No cloud. No data centres. No internet connection required. The benchmark for successful augmented human AI is not a Turing test against a stranger - it is whether the person themselves, their close friends and their family cannot distinguish the difference between real and AI. Our benchmark is reality and the human experience. This is the first step on the path to real-time intelligent augmented humans with private knowledge, memory, insight and personality. Professor Yi-Zhe Song is one of the UK's most accomplished AI researchers - a Professor of Computer Vision and AI at the University of Surrey, Director of the world-leading SketchX Lab, Co-Director of the Surrey Institute for People-Centred AI, and Academic Lead at The Alan Turing Institute, the UK's national institute for data science and AI. Ranked consistently in Stanford University's World Top 2% Scientists list, his research into how human drawing informs machine vision has shaped the field for over two decades. His team’s NitroFusion, one of the world’s first single-step diffusion model for near-instant image generation on consumer hardware, demonstrated the core principle behind Turing Elite’s ‘Me’ model: that frontier-quality generative AI can run entirely on local compute. In this episode of Gaea Talks, host Graeme Scott sits down with Max Sebti, Co-Founder and CEO of Score, to explore how AI moves beyond chatbots and into real-world decision systems.Using elite football as a case study, Max explains how his team built a fully automated vision AI system capable of annotating an entire match in under two minutes — more accurately than human analysts. From there, the conversation expands into one of sport’s biggest unsolved challenges: how to objectively measure and translate player performance across leagues, regions, and tactical systems in a scalable, non-biased way.But this discussion goes far beyond sport. Together, they examine why framing the right business problem matters more than model accuracy, how hedge fund principles apply to AI and performance modelling, the risks of centralised AI systems trained on the same datasets, and the ethical implications of data labelling at scale. They also explore the intersection of AI and energy, the future of decentralised systems, and what all of this means for leadership, productivity, and the future of work.This is a conversation about leverage, transparency, and how to think strategically about AI in the real world. Melissa Reeve is an organizational transformation and AI integration expert who focuses on how companies must evolve—not just technologically, but structurally and culturally—to succeed with AI. Rather than concentrating on tools or models, her work examines how leadership, operating models, governance, and human systems must change as AI becomes embedded in everyday work.Drawing on decades of experience across lean manufacturing, agile systems, and enterprise transformation, Melissa has worked at the intersection of strategy, execution, and change. Her thinking was shaped early by studying the Toyota Production System in Japan and later through leadership roles in scaling agile and enterprise-wide transformation initiatives.She is the author of Hyperadaptive: Rewiring the Enterprise to Become AI-Native, where she outlines a practical, staged approach for helping organizations move from isolated AI experiments to becoming adaptive, learning enterprises that can sense and respond at AI speed. Her work is particularly focused on the “messy middle” of transformation—where people, roles, incentives, and culture collide with new technological capabilities.In this episode of GAEA Talks, Melissa shares insights for leaders navigating AI adoption at scale, including why most AI initiatives stall, how to overcome resistance, and what it really takes to build organizations that evolve alongside AI rather than being disrupted by it. This podcast features a discussion with Richard Saldanha, who shares his background of spending 25 years in the City of London as a risk analyst, quant trader, portfolio manager and even serving as a global head of risk for a large investment manager. His career has focused on linking mathematics, problem-solving and real-world issues. He has an academic background, holding a doctorate in graph theory and multivariate statistics from the University of Oxford.
